  About the Author

  Peter Gill was born in England and educated in Longridge, Blackburn and Reading—from where he went to Oxford but left early when he realised there wasn’t quite enough of interest to sustain a full weekend. On the occasions when work has troubled his day he has conveyed the impression of being a research scientist, radio journalist, college lecturer, something in IT, PR drone, and itinerant sheep shearer.

  Extirpated from his native Lancashire he now lives in a Shropshire home, accompanied by one wife, up to four daughters, a cat, the F dog, five chickens and six goldfish. He has promised never, ever, to try and keep stick insects again. His time is largely divided between the kitchen and a room on the top floor with a handy bolt on the outside.

  Peter was third by one quarter of an inch in the Coach and Horses longest runner bean competition (his bean, not personally), and 42: Douglas Adams’ Amazingly Accurate Answer to Life, the Universe and Everything is his first book if you’re not counting the pamphlet on electric fencing.
